@Loujonesy ovarian cysts can be very common, I've had one when I wasn't pregnant and was getting pains so went for tests which showed said cyst and they monitored it. Cysts can grow and change throughout the monthly cycle due to hormones. So maybe they are double checking it at the 20 week scan to see if it's grown etc. It doesn't mean it's anything serious. Did they say how big it was? Try not to worry.
